History and development:
Online poker appeared inside late 1990s as a consequence of breakthroughs in technology and the net. The very first on-line poker room, globe Poker, was released in 1998, attracting a tiny but passionate neighborhood. However, it was at the first 2000s that on-line poker experienced exponential growth, mostly due to the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.

Benefits of On-line Poker:
Online poker provides several advantages over traditional brick-and-mortar gambling enterprises. Firstly, it offers a broader array of game choices, including various poker variants and stakes, catering towards choices and budgets of all forms of players. Also, on-line poker spaces are open 24/7, getting rid of the constraints of actual casino running hours. Furthermore, internet based systems usually offer appealing bonuses, loyalty programs, while the capacity to play several tables at the same time, enhancing the overall video gaming knowledge.
